BLACK HISTORY MONTH
February on TV One
The Silver Spring-based network is carrying special programming dedicated to Black History Month.
Broadcasts include an "In Conver-sation . . . " special on Sunday at 9 p.m., featuring the Rev. Al Sharpton and guests discussing allegations of police brutality. Other broadcasts include "The Color Purple: The Color of Success" and a "TV One on One" interview with Harry Belafonte, both on Feb. 18. TV One's black history salute continues through March 3.

COVERED IN CHOCOLATE WEEK
Starting Monday on Food Network
Chocoholics, celebrate: Food Network is serving chocolate-flavored shows through Feb. 11. For an appetizer, sample the special "All Star Chocolate" on Wednesday at 9 p.m., in which Tyler Florence and other network favorites offer chocolate recipes. "Emeril Live: Chocolate Challenge" on Feb. 11 at 8 p.m. showcases viewers' top chocolate choices, including Double Chocolate Buzz Buzz cookies. "Chocolate Runway Challenge," also Feb. 11, gives new meaning to the term "dress for excess": five top pastry chefs whip up evening gowns fashioned entirely of chocolate.
